Belfast-born, Berlin-based DJ and producer Sally C is renowned for her "Chunker sound," blending vintage house, acid, hip house, and breakbeat. Her high-energy sets and releases on her label, Big Saldo's Chunkers, have earned global acclaim. Popular tracks include "Let's Get This" and "Hips Yo Thighs" (with Eliza Rose). She is known for her authentic style and dedication to community.
Kepler is a Leeds-based DJ and producer prominent in the underground house and garage scene. Known for his distinctive sound featuring timeless grooves and driving basslines, he has performed at iconic venues such as Fabric, Amnesia, and Depot Mayfield, with releases on acclaimed labels like FUSE, Up The Stuss, and Constant Sound.
New York-born, Paris-raised DJ, producer, and multi-instrumentalist Chloé Caillet crafts genre-fluid sets blending house, disco, and electronic sounds. Her acclaimed debut EP "Intro" and tracks like "The One" showcase her vibrant style. Caillet is recognized for high-energy performances and her inclusive SMIILE club nights, earning accolades and collaborating with notable artists.
Dennis Cruz, a significant figure in underground house and tech, is widely acclaimed, topping charts, and winning numerous awards including Best Producer at the DJ Awards 2017. Known for hits on Beatport, he collaborates with stars like Jamie Jones.
Leeds-based duo Prospa, Harvey Blumler and Gosha Smith, blend classic house and rave sounds. Known for "Prayer" (2018) and "Control the Party" (2019 EP), they revived Stress Records.
Seth Troxler, from Kalamazoo, Michigan, is an American DJ and producer. He blends house, techno, and minimal sounds, drawing on Detroit and Chicago influences. A Resident Advisor #1 DJ, he also earned a Grammy nomination. Troxler co-founded Visionquest and leads labels like Tuskegee. He is known for tracks such as "Each Step" and "Play In The Dark," and for his charismatic sets.
Chilean DJ, producer and vocalist based in Bristol, Shanti Celeste makes electronic music spanning house, techno and downtempo with a pop sheen. Her second album Romance was produced in Bristol and London, putting her vocals front and centre.
Amsterdam-born Dutch house producer Dennis Quin blends heavy basslines and infectious rhythms across tech house and deep house. His 2019 remix of You’re In My System opened doors internationally; he also runs the label EARDRUMS and event series QuINvites.
Sidney Charles is a DJ and producer known for his house music style dubbed The Sidney Sound, marked by heavy low ends, chunky drums and dark, hard-hitting rhythms. Key tracks include House Lessons and Warehouse Romance; released on Truesoul, Hot Creations and Saved.
Puerto Rico-born DJ, vocalist, and producer Natalia Roth began her path in 2014. Inspired by techno raves, she developed a minimal house and techno sound, blending minimal tech and techno. Now based in Miami, she founded the party brand Melódie.
Enzo Siragusa is a London DJ and producer rooted in early ’90s British rave culture. He makes bass-heavy tracks and leads ambitious ventures including FUSE, ranked among London’s most revered brands, while steering labels and hosting sellout events.
The Warehouse Project, born in Manchester in 2006, is a renowned seasonal club series. It transforms unique spaces into temporary electronic music hubs, celebrated for showcasing diverse genres from house and techno to drum and bass. Known for attracting top-tier DJs, it was named the "World's Favourite Nightclub" in 2023.
Luuk van Dijk is an Amsterdam-based DJ and producer, born in 1996 to musical parents. He is celebrated for his house music, featuring groovy basslines and an old-school energy. He has released on labels like Hot Creations and his own Dark Side Of The Sun, with popular tracks including "Disco Tetris" and "Good 4 U." He is recognized as an "Artist To Watch."
French DJ/producer Traumer (Romain Poncet) is known for minimal grooves and hypnotic narratives. Founder of get-traum (2016), he’s released on Berg Audio, Desolat and FUSE London, and collaborates with DJ Deep (Sergie Rezza, Adventice) and Anton (Antraum).
An Australian-born, London-based minimal house and techno DJ and producer, known for her artfully curated sets and as the founder of the music project Roots.
Netherlands DJ/producer Marsolo rose through Beatport No.1 releases Step by Step and chart-topper Spaceship. Named Mixmag’s Top 25 Breakthrough DJs of 2025 and on Tomorrowland’s 20 Artists of 2026 watchlist; sold out a debut UK All Night Long tour.
L.P. Rhythm is a house music artist channeling vintage 90s grooves. He’s earned support from Chris Stussy, Enzo Siragusa, Pawsa, Job Jobse, Patrick Topping, ANOTR and Rossi, and has played clubs across England and parties in Lisbon, Amsterdam and Dublin.
Netherlands-based multi-instrumentalist, DJ and producer M-High is part of a new wave of house artists spanning tech, deep and minimal. His sound has been featured on Pilot, Hot Creations and Berg Audio, and played at fabric and Awakenings.
Josh Baker, a Manchester, UK-born DJ and producer, is a leading figure in house and electronic music. Known for electrifying sets and groove-heavy tracks like "Back It Up" and "You Don't Own Me," he founded You&Me Records, Hide&Seek Festival, SYNTHO, and his label Baker's Dozen. A DJ Mag Best of British 2024 award winner, Baker shapes the UK electronic scene.
A rapidly rising Dutch DJ and producer based in Amsterdam, known for his distinct underground house music sound that blends nostalgic 90s house with robust basslines and contagious melodies.
Jamback is a house artist whose releases on Whippin and Airtime Records drew support from Toman, Chris Stussy and Archie Hamilton. His Roaring 20’s EP on PIV Records hit #1 on Beatport Deep House, and 2023’s At the House EP landed on Eastenderz.
Julian Fijma is an underground electronic artist from Enkhuizen, Netherlands, now based in Hoorn near Amsterdam. Known for heavy basslines, refreshing synths and groovy drums, his releases have earned support from East End Dubs, Chris Stussy, Josh Baker and Enzo Siragusa.
Stef Davidse is a Dutch house DJ/producer whose tracks have been played in 163 countries. Known for deep basslines, sharp synths and creative vocal samples, he has released on Eastenderz, Microhertz, NeXup and WYLD, with support from Jamie Jones.
The Trip is a London-based DJ and production project by Max van Dijk and Oli Hiam, founders of the Tessellate record label and party. Active since 2013, their distinctive, sample-heavy style draws on UKG, progressive, tech house, and house influences. Known for their curated events, they have earned acclaim, including a DJ Mag Best of British Breakthrough Producer Award nomination.

About Freight Island

Freight Island, a 3,000-capacity urban market and entertainment complex in Manchester, UK, is reimagined from the historic Mayfield station's former freight depot, celebrating its industrial architecture. This multifaceted destination offers a dynamic blend of live music, diverse food, and immersive cultural events across its unique indoor and outdoor spaces.
